My two cents: It looks like an aerodynamic issue of Cm curve for 0.6 mach (NASA TP-1538) still being used in ground effect, hence the pitch instability.
Cm

The FLCS also contributes to this by:

  1. AOA feedback sets to zero upon MLG WOW. Which means the pitch-down command above 10 degrees AOA, and the static stability gain schedule on AOA, is no more.
    AOA feedback nulls

  2. LEF deflects -2 degrees upon MLG WOW, which can create a pitch-up moment.

A real solution would be creating a Cm table for ground effect and take-off & landing roll. But that would not be easy finding the right coefficients.

A workaround solution is to modify the FLCS control logic to compensate for that instability. For example, change the logic switches that are based on MLG WOW to NLG WOW, so that the AOA feedback above 10 degrees and the static stability gain schedule can be utilised. (Or more importantly, the pitch integrator can be utilised to null the pitch-rate.)

I had forgotten you suggested that. Came to the same idea last night, due to Josh finding out that not stopping the AoA paths fixed the issue plus Reaper suggesting that there was a switch with NLG that maybe should be MLG (that was not used in control though).

The only thing I did was change the switch for AOA from MLG to NLG.

Anyway, is committed with 146b05f (the commit refers issue 170, should have been this issue). And it does indeed fix it (at least its much less), even without integrator help.
